Concrete lifting services offer practical solutions for property owners in Pinellas County, FL dealing with uneven or sunken slabs. Over time, soil settling, erosion, or changes in moisture levels can cause concrete surfaces such as driveways, walkways, or patios to shift or crack, affecting both appearance and functionality. Professional concrete lifting helps restore these surfaces to their proper level, improving safety by reducing trip hazards and enhancing the overall usability of outdoor spaces.
Choosing concrete lifting can also provide benefits related to durability and curb appeal. Properly leveled surfaces are less prone to further damage, which can reduce long-term maintenance needs. Additionally, a well-maintained and even concrete surface enhances the visual appeal of a property, making it more inviting and increasing its overall value. Concrete lifting services involve the process of raising and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ces. This typically includes the use of specialized equipment and materials to lift and stabilize slabs such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ors. The goal is to restore the surface to a proper, level position, improving both safety and appearance without the need for complete replacement. These services are often chosen for their efficiency and ability to address issues with minimal disruption to the property.
One of the primary problems concrete lifting services help solve is uneven or settled concrete that can create tripping hazards or drainage issues. Over time, soil erosion, freeze-thaw cycles, or poor initial installation can cause concrete slabs to sink or crack. By lifting and leveling these surfaces, property owners can prevent accidents, reduce potential liability, and maintain the structural integrity of walkways and driveways. Additionally, restoring the level surface can improve the overall aesthetic of outdoor spaces and enhance cur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Lifting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pinellas County,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Concrete lifting services typically cost between $500 and $2,500 per slab, depending on size and extent of the unevenness. Larger or more complex projects may reach higher prices within this range.
Factors Affecting Price - The total cost can vary based on the number of slabs, access difficulty, and the type of lifting method used. For example, a small porch lift may be closer to $500, while a large driveway could be around $2,000 or more.
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in the Pinellas County area might expect to pay roughly $1,200 for standard concrete lifting work. Costs can fluctuate based on local market conditions and specific project requirements.
Additional Costs - Some projects may incur extra charges for crack repairs, surface leveling, or additional stabilization. These supplementary services can add several hundred dollars to the overall expense.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
